As climate change accelerates, the need for a transition to renewable energy resources, like responsibly developed offshore wind energy, offers a promising path forward. Offshore wind energy can help Texas meet rising energy demand, create jobs, and do so in an environmentally responsible way that establishes clear protections for wildlife and habitats.

Special guest Dr. Elizabeth Nyman from Texas A&M at Galveston will join to share recent polling and research on the outlook for offshore wind in the Gulf.
